The Central Asia–Afghanistan Relationship: From Soviet Intervention to the Silk Road Initiatives - Contemporary Central Asia: Societies, Politics, and Cultures
The Central Asia–Afghanistan Relationship: From Soviet Intervention to the Silk Road Initiatives - Contemporary Central Asia: Societies, Politics, and Cultures
This collection provides a broad analysis of Afghanistan and its neighbors in recent decades and investigates the various historical and political contexts into which the region has been placed. It examines the legacy of Soviet intervention, patterns of cooperation and conflict among regional states, and recent US strategic initiatives.
